Cancellation Policy Details

Wakayama Castle Town Walking Tour - Cancellation Policy Details

To understand the cancellation policy for the Wakayama Castle Town Walking Tour, guests need to be aware of the following key details. When managing expectations, it is crucial to plan cancellations accordingly. If changes in plans arise, exploring alternatives is essential. Below is a breakdown of the cancellation policy details for the tour:

Cancellation Policy Details
Full Refund Cancel up to 24 hours in advance.
Refund Cut-off Must cancel at least 24 hours before start time.
No Refund Cancellation less than 24 hours before start time.
Changes Not Accepted No changes within 24 hours of the start time.
